Recyclable Pet Food Pouches

Purina Introduced New Pet Food Packaging in the UK

These recyclable pet food pouches have been introduced by Purina in the UK to give some of the brand's products a more eco-friendly edge and keep them relevant for today's consumers.

The Nestle-owned brand is using the recyclable pouches for its Gourmet wet cat food across the Mon Petit range with additional products expected to use them in the near-future. The new packaging will be debuted in the UK, but also across Europe for a total of 20 countries in all.

Head of Packaging for Nestle UK & Ireland Sokhna Gueye commented on the new recyclable pet food pouches saying, "The new mono material pouches are another great example of our commitment to using simpler packaging, making recycling easier for pet owners. These new pouches demonstrate progress.”
